Started in October of 1972 by Del and Helen Chapin, Valley Corporation was built on a foundation of small town family values of tradition, quality, and pride in our work. Del started out with small commercial projects.  The company grew after being purchased by Roger and Bonnie Bevington in 1977, who expanded the services to include building, concrete work, and sea walls.

Today, Valley Corporation’s current President and Owner, Matt Bevington, has continued the family’s legacy.  Valley Corporation has expanded to offer services in the commercial, industrial and heavy highway fields.  Specializing in Grading, Utilities, Demolition, Concrete and Asphalt Recycling, Sheet Piling, Stabilization, Heavy Highway, Structures and Emergency Repairs.
